Terms, Conditions & Eligibility

  • Option Clause: Purchaser may increase/decrease quantity by up to 25% during contract and extended periods
  • Delivery Schedule: Delivery begins from the last date of the original delivery order; additional time calculated as (Increased quantity ÷ Original quantity) × Original delivery period, minimum 30 days; extension possible up to original delivery period
  • Scope of Supply: Bid price must include Supply, Installation, Testing and Commissioning of goods
  • ATC: Internal Buyer Added ATC document governs terms; bidders must comply with these terms for eligibility

Technical Specifications 1 Item

Item #1 Details

View Catalog
Category Specification Requirement
Product Characteristics Operating Time (Number of operation hours per day X number of days in week) 24 x 7
Display Characteristics Diagonal Display Size (in inches) Between 70 and 80 (177.8 - 203.2 cm)
Display Characteristics Display Technology LED (Light Emitting Diode)
Display Characteristics Native Resolution of Display (Pixels) Ultra HD (3840 x 2160)
